The best way to avoid problems like this is to perform regular maintenance.The smooth and sleek sliding patio doors are easy to shut and open however dirt can build up in the bottom track over time, causing them to become stuck or difficult to move. Begin by removing any loose debris with an air vacuum or brush, and scrubbing the dirt using a toothbrush or a small cleaning brush that has been soaked in warm soapy water. You can also use vinegar and baking soda to make a paste can be applied to grimy areas, allowing the paste to react with dirt for a couple of minutes before scrubbing it off.After cleaning the tracks, apply a silicone-based lubricant to reduce friction and help the door move smoothly. You can purchase lubricant at an online store for home improvement Be sure to look over the label and select one specifically designed for use on metal tracks. Aluminum tracks do not require lubrication because they aren't rusty, but you must be sure to clean them regularly to avoid accumulating dirt and debris.Broken rollers may also cause a sliding door to become stuck or slide off its track. If you see any obvious damage, you might just have to lubricate the tracks.A damaged or defective weatherstripping system can cause an unresponsive patio door. Examine the area thoroughly and replace the worn stripping when necessary, which will not only improve your door's performance but also enhance the efficiency of your energy and decrease noise.A patio door is a significant investment and if you don't maintain it you may end up needing repairs or replacement work more frequently than you expect. Window World Twin Cities will assist you in selecting the best set of French or sliding doors for your house.One of the most effective ways to detect an opening in your patio door is to shine a flashlight on the door at night, while someone else stands in the door and moves it left and right. If you see light streaming in from the gap, you'll have to repair or replace the weatherstripping or sweep. To do this, you must first remove the old weatherstripping and clean the frame with ruby alcohol prior to installing the new material. It is also an excellent idea to take out the screws that hold the stop molding, making it easier to remove the patio door. This will ensure that the new weatherstripping sticks properly.
